Biography
Diana "ladidai" Umana is a versatile creator, content consultant, and multimedia journalist known for her innovative work in music, technology, and the creator economy at large. Her content has led her to work with global brands like TikTok, Amazon, TIDAL, and Instagram. Hailing from Yonkers, NY, with a background as a multi-genre songwriter, ladidai has had her music licensed to several major networks and global publishers like Fox, NBCUniversal, BET, and Warner Chappell. Notably, she earned the prestigious ASCAP Foundation Harold Adamson Lyric Award for Rhythm & Soul in 2018. ladidai has since expanded her influence beyond music creation, making significant contributions to the independent music scene by leading content and social media operations for artist hub HRDRV and nonprofit Gender Amplified. Her expertise led her to spearhead content and social strategy for megastars like Ashanti, where she orchestrated the successful launch of Ashanti's onchain music collection, selling over $100,000 worth of product in a single day in March 2022. Later that same year, in the summer, she began managing pop-fusion artist TK, who has gone on to make 6 figures a year independently ever since. In March 2023, ladidai co-launched the Amazon-recognized audiovisual podcast "Hear Us Out: The Music & Media Blueprint" with Rhyver White, offering practical career advice to rising music and media professionals. In March 2024, ladidai successfully completed her program at the first-ever ONE Creator Lab, powered by The One Club for Creativity, which equips content creators to succeed in the worlds of media and marketing. She's an active member of various organizations in music and media including The Recording Academy and The One Club for Creativity. Her work has been published in Yahoo!, NYLON, Business Insider, and REVOLT and was chosen as one of a select few writers across the world to be a part of Yahoo!’s inaugural creator pilot in July 2024. Further, ladidai has been invited to speak on several podcasts and panels about personal branding, the creator economy, emerging technology, and more from USC to NFT NYC. With a passion for people and culture, ladidai continues to push boundaries and make a meaningful impact in the world through creation, curation, and consulting—one piece of content at a time.

Freelancer.com is the largest freelancing and crowdsourcing marketplace in the world, connecting over 81 million employers and freelancers across more than 247 countries. Founded in 2009 and based in Sydney, Australia, the platform allows employers to post jobs while freelancers can bid on these projects. It is publicly traded on the Australian Securities Exchange under the ticker ASX:FLN. The platform supports a variety of work categories, including software development, writing, design, and marketing. Freelancer.com also offers contests for creative work, where employers can award prize money to winning entries. Users can choose from different membership plans, including free and paid subscriptions, which provide various benefits. The mobile app enhances project management and communication for users on the go. With a diverse customer base that includes individuals, small businesses, and large enterprises, Freelancer.com plays a significant role in the global online economy.
